30/09/2018, 21:08

Tự học lập trình nên bắt đầu từ đâu?

Chào các bạn. Mình ko phải dân CNTT cũng chưa biết tí gì về lập trình nhưng mình muốn học và tự học qua hd trên mạng thôi.
Mình ko biết nên bắt đầu từ đâu và học ntn mong mọi người chỉ giúp mình.
thanhks.

Người bí ẩn viết 23:15 ngày 30/09/2018

Xem Topic này nhé: Cho em hỏi về người mới học lập trình?

Mới học lập trình => Học C hoặc Python rồi đến C++ …

P/S: Đầu tháng 7 này, admin forum @ltd sẽ ra 1 khóa C++ rất chất lượng cho toàn member: Giới thiệu về khóa học C++ dành cho người chưa biết hoặc biết một ít về lập trình

Trường Giang viết 23:09 ngày 30/09/2018

Mình khuyên bạn nên chọn hướng đi trước ( Web, Di động, ứng dụng, Vi điều khiển, Hệ thống nhúng…) sau đó chọn 1 ngôn ngữ để học song song với việc luyện giải thuật

Minh Le viết 23:11 ngày 30/09/2018

mình có tìm hiểu python nhưng mình thấy hd trên mạng dành cho python2 còn python3 thì ít tài liệu hd quá. nên học python 2 hay 3 ạ.
các bạn cho mình hỏi thêm nếu học C thì nên chọn phiên bản nào để học (cho phù hợp với học qua mạng )

Minh Le viết 23:21 ngày 30/09/2018

mục tiêu của mình là viết những phần mềm tiện ích trong cs.
mình có tìm hiểu python nhưng mình thấy hd trên mạng dành cho python2 còn python3 thì ít tài liệu hd quá. nên học python 2 hay 3 ạ.
các bạn cho mình hỏi thêm nếu học C thì nên chọn phiên bản nào để học (cho phù hợp với học qua mạng )

Người bí ẩn viết 23:18 ngày 30/09/2018

Bạn học ở channel nào nhỉ?

mình có tìm hiểu python nhưng mình thấy hd trên mạng dành cho python2 còn python3 thì ít tài liệu hd quá. nên học python 2 hay 3 ạ.

Học Python tại channel Dạy Nhau Học của anh Lê Trần Đạt nhé:
Playlist: https://www.youtube.com/playlist?list=PLyiioioEJSxEh_S_XFvG0d2xKRMSWLfN_

các bạn cho mình hỏi thêm nếu học C thì nên chọn phiên bản nào để học (cho phù hợp với học qua mạng )

Mình không hiểu lắm, mình chưa nghe C có nhiều phiên bản? Nhưng học C là để làm nên tảng học các ngôn ngữ cao hơn như C++ ; Java ; C-sharp ; … còn nếu bạn xác định theo lập trình nhúng như anh @ltd thì C và C++
Playlist: https://www.youtube.com/playlist?list=PLyiioioEJSxHr5X8RNY3QXUGcjzeZeI7l
Playlist thêm(của anh Sơn): https://www.youtube.com/playlist?list=PLq9VOPepajsCbKVpZMw6eiwrJrRkZkklI

P/S: Nếu học Python thì đọc cuốn sách Learn Python The Hard Way. Còn C thì đọc thêm cuốn Head First C (tùy bạn chọn)

Lê Đại Tú viết 23:14 ngày 30/09/2018

có nhiều hướng cho Bạn đi. Bạn phải xác định bẠN lập trình web hay mobile hoặc pc chẳng hạn.
Ví dụ: nếu web thì Bạn bắt đầu với html + css. mobile và pc thì c, c++ .

Minh Le viết 23:19 ngày 30/09/2018

mình hướng đến những ứng dụng giải trí, học tập…

Minh Le viết 23:17 ngày 30/09/2018

cảm ơn bạn có lẽ mình sẽ danh thêm thời gian để đọc về cả C và python rồi mới quyết định học cái gì.
mình biết đến diễn đàn là qua video hd python trên youtube của a Đạt, mặc dù ko biết về lập trình nhưng mình thấy hd cũng hay và dễ nghe.
Cảm ơn tất cả mọi người.

Người bí ẩn viết 23:23 ngày 30/09/2018

Ừ, cố lên. Ban đầu chưa biết cái gì mình cũng chẳng biết nên học ngôn ngữ nào cho hợp.
Sau khi học xong hết C, mình mới biết là cần học cái nào

Minh Le viết 23:09 ngày 30/09/2018

các bạn cho mình hỏi thêm mình có thể đồng thời cài nhiều ngôn ngữ lập trình vd C, Python… không? nếu cài nhiều ngôn ngữ như vậy thì khi chạy có vấn đề gì không?

Anh Pham viết 23:19 ngày 30/09/2018

cài ngôn ngữ là thế nào. Bạn này chả có tí căn bản nào về máy tính à. Bạn xem qua những clip trên kia chưa?
Ko có khái niệm cài nn mà chỉ có duy nhất cài phần mềm và bạn thích cài bao nhiêu cũng được nếu máy tính đủ mạnh ko ảnh hưởng gì

Trần Ngọc Khoa viết 23:19 ngày 30/09/2018

Ngôn ngữ thực ra là cú pháp. Con cái mà bạn cài là IDE hoặc Compiler thôi. Cài nhiều nói chung cũng không ảnh hưởng mấy.

Minh Le viết 23:25 ngày 30/09/2018

mình cài và dùng rồi nhưng mình ko biết là dùng song song 2 ngôn ngữ lập trình như vậy thì nó có ảnh hưởng đến nhau ko thôi.
như trên mình đã nói rồi mà mình ko dân CNTT, biết dùng máy tính nhưng ko hiểu nó.

Hung viết 23:25 ngày 30/09/2018

Tự học thì bắt đầu từ các hướng dẫn căn bản nhất.
Tốt nhất nên bắt đầu từ các khóa học có sự đầu tư, được trình bày rõ ràng của các tổ chức uy tín như Lynda, Microsoft, Oracle…
Ở các khóa này, họ sẽ trình bày cho bạn rõ ràng ít thiếu sót, còn các cá nhân tự dạy thì đôi khi thiếu sót chỗ này chỗ kia.
Tuy nhiên, học cái gì cũng vậy, nếu bạn bám lấy nó thì nó sẽ bám lấy bạn, dù bạn bắt đầu học từ những khóa không đầy đủ, nhưng bạn tiếp tục học thì kiến thức sau này sẽ bù đắp lại, có điều quá trình nó lâu hơn người học có bài bản.
Ban đầu, bạn nên chọn học C# hoặc Java.

Thanos viết 23:22 ngày 30/09/2018

Học Python hết mấy tháng ạ? Còn kịp để học C++ ko ạ? hihi ^^^

Thanos viết 23:23 ngày 30/09/2018

Còn Python có tác dụng gì cho web ko ạ?
Em thấy mọi người thường bắt đầu bằng 1 ngôn ngữ nào đó, nhưng em chưa hiểu có phải đó là để mình làm quen với lập trình ko, hay là nó phải có tác dụng gì nữa chứ ạ?
Ví dụ em bắt đầu làm newbie học Python thì nó có ứng dụng gì ko ạ?
P/S: Em định theo hướng web ạ ^^

Người bí ẩn viết 23:18 ngày 30/09/2018

Cái đó không thể nói được vì nó còn tùy thuộc vào người học, kế hoạch, năng lực và điều kiện. Nếu bạn học yếu thì nửa năm, nhanh thì 3 tháng. Ngoài ra còn học sâu hay không sâu nữa

Duong Vu viết 23:17 ngày 30/09/2018

Có thể vừa học làm web vs game k ạ??? Hay chỉ làm 1 trong 2 thứ đó ạ!!! E là newbie ạ

Bài liên quan
0